Quotes by Jean Rostand, Thoughts of a biologist (1939)

"To be an adult is to be alone."
By Jean Rostand, Thoughts of a biologist (1939)
Send to friend

"Kill one man, and you are a murderer. Kill millions of men, and you are a conqueror. Kill them all, and you are a god."
By Jean Rostand, Thoughts of a Biologist (1939)
